Start your wine tasting by observing the wine in your glass. The shade can reveal lots about the wine’s age and varietal. Take notes on the hue, readability, and viscosity. A well-structured tasting note usually contains this visible evaluation because it forms the foundation of your analysis. While it could seem trivial, the visual side is essential in wine tasting.

After your visible assessment, it's time to take a mild whiff. Swirl the wine in your glass to aerate it, releasing its aroma. This is the place tasting notes become significantly useful. Make notes concerning the totally different scents you detect—fruits, spices, or floral hints. Identifying these aromas will help you put words to the intrinsic complexities of the wine you might be sampling.
The next crucial step is the tasting itself. Take a small sip and let the wine roll over your palate. Note the flavors you experience. Are they sweet or tart? The Place does your palate detect every flavor? Some wines might present immediate sweetness followed by a tannic end. Use your tasting notes to document these layers, making a roadmap of your sensory experience.
Think About also the mouthfeel of the wine as you taste. Is it easy, crisp, creamy, or maybe tannic? This textural quality significantly influences the overall enjoyment and impression of the wine. Observing the mouthfeel can reveal the standard and craftsmanship behind the winemaking course of.
It's beneficial to check completely different wines as you taste them. If you're sampling a flight with contrasting varietals, make an observation of the variations you perceive. How does the acidity vary from one wine to another? Which wine feels fuller, and which is extra refreshing? This comparative train deepens your understanding and helps sharpen your analytical skills.
